Girls were educated like boys initially, however the major purpose was to organize them to run a family. Their position was to raise kids and manage the household – particularly if their husbands couldn’t afford enslaved people.
In most modern countries right now, romantic love is the rationale that people marry, but on the time period of four hundred BCE, marriages have been organized. Fathers had authorized management over their daughters until an appropriate match was found for them.

The feminine members of the Academy did not attain to such distinction as did the Pythagorean Women. The latter were of Dorian blood, and lived, based on the principles of their order, in the best simplicity and trade; the former were mainly of Ionian inventory and were extra inclined to lives of ease and luxurious. Consequently, they didn’t cultivate these domestic virtues which made the Pythagorean Women so superior. Athens was not the place for feminine ambition to obtain proper recognition, and the honorable maids and matrons couldn’t, if they wished, pursue the study of philosophy in affiliation with the male intercourse; hence the female component of the Academy was composed of strangers, who had been attracted to Athens by the celebrity of the thinker. The Neo-pythagorean philosopher, Iamblichus, in his biography of Pythagoras mentions fifteen celebrated ladies of the School.

The plan of a Greek house signifies how secluded woman’s complete life was to be. In the interior a half of the Greek mansion, separated from the entrance of the building by a door, lay thegyncæconitis, or women’s apartments, normally built round a courtroom. Here have been bedrooms, dining-rooms, the nursery, the rooms for spinning and weaving, where the girl of the house sat at her wheel.

In anger, she made the earth barren, and would not allow the crops to spring up again till her daughter was allowed to spend two-thirds of the year together with her mom among the Immortals, devoting the remaining third to her gloomy partner within the realms of Hades. Upon her return to Olympus, Demeter left the gift of corn, of agriculture, and of her holy mysteries, along with her host, and despatched Triptolemus the Eleusinian concerning the earth to reveal to men the data of agriculture, of civil order, and of holy wedlock. Thus the worship of Demeter, as the founder of law and order and marriage, became prevalent, and exerted a most useful influence throughout Hellas.
The wedding ceremony day was celebrated by a feast supplied by the groom in the house of the bride’s father. All the visitors had been clad in their most costly raiment, and they brought presents to the young couple. In these patriarchal times, when the father was each chief and pontiff, so that his approval gave a sacred character to the union, the leading away of the bride from the home of her father appears to have constituted an important act of the wedding ceremony. In the description of the Shield of Achilles, Homer offers us a glimpse of this solemnity. Under the glow of torches, surrounded by a joyous company, dancing and singing hymeneal songs, the bride was led to the house of her future husband. She was veiled, a custom that was a survival of the old try to avoid angering the ancestral spirits by withdrawing unceremoniously from their surveillance.

There were processions and rustic dances, and all the standard options of the carnival, as the revellers became increasingly under the influence of the god. In these revels, women consecrated to this divinity, and known as Bacchantes or Mænads, formed a particular group. The symbol of their worship was a thyrsus–a pole ending with a bunch of vine or ivy leaves, or with a pine cone and a fillet. All the Greek peoples gloried in being of the identical blood and language and faith. Though broadly separated politically and engaged in endless wars amongst themselves, the chief bond of union known to them was the frequent cult of some divinity and participation in the identical non secular festivals. The oracles, the temples, the video games, the processions in honor of their gods, tended to take care of the unity of Greece and were the promoters of national sentiment.
There have been, after all, additionally partners, the famous “Hetaires” who have been normally slaves or “metoikoi” and performed a particular function in males’s social and erotic life. They saved them firm in their symposia, entertained them, and mentioned with them numerous topics, even philosophical ones. They were the only class of women who had a level of training, so as to have the flexibility to entertain the boys. They had been typically extra cultured than the opposite Athenian girls; they often knew the way to play a musical instrument , sang and cite poetry. Some Hetaires, such as Pericles’ spouse, Aspasia, gained fame in Athenian life on the time, indicating that they were not necessarily marginalized. Although monogamy was the norm in historic Athens, prostitution was not thought of illegal, nor had been relations with pallakides, the younger women from very poor families who got to rich Athenians by their parents with a purpose no other than to satisfy them sexually whenever they pleased.
